Modifications: Early 1920s storefront modifications. During 1930s, changes made to exterior and interior. In 1956, storefront completely remodeled. Between 1956 and 1974, metal awning installed. At an unknown date, replaced by a modern fabric awning. In 2014, building owners received a CDBG grant to carry out facade improvements. The facade was repainted. New anodized aluminum storefront and signage was installed.
Height: Two story.
Walls: Brick, painted.
Storefront: Aluminum display windows and doors, brick kneewalls, awning.
Windows: Wood 1/1 double hung, wood transoms.
Stylistic features: Bay window, tracery, finials, battlements, miniature turret.
